What is a Registered Agent for a San Diego LLC or Corporation

Registered Agent for a San Diego LLC or Corporation

What is a registered agent for a San Diego LLC or Corporation.  All San Diego businesses must have a “Registered Agent” for their LLC, S-Corporation or C-Corporation.  A corporate entity cannot, by law, legally receive paperwork related to the business.  They are an entity.  Legal paperwork must be received by an “agent” – an actual person who is able to sign for the receipt of important paperwork such as service papers, or forms and correspondence by agencies such as the IRS, California tax agencies or the California Secretary of State.

Your registered agent for a San Diego LLC or Corporation must have a street address within California.  This is where documents may be served upon your LLC or corporation during regular business hours.  California law requires every company to have a registered agent for a San Diego LLC or corporation.
